Perez-Diaz Named to Lead Firstmark Foundation

SAN ANTONIOFirstmark Credit Union has named Marisa Pérez-Díaz as the executive director of the Firstmark Foundation, a non-profit public charity focused on making a tangible, positive impact in the education community.

Pérez-Díaz has nearly 10 years of experience in the K-12 and higher education system as a former school district administrator, university co-instructor and member of the Texas State Board of Education.

“We are excited to have Marisa join Firstmark and to launch our Foundation,” said Nathanael Tarwasokono, president and CEO of Firstmark Credit Union. “We look forward to making a positive impact in schools throughout the community on behalf of our members.”

As executive director, Pérez-Díaz will collaborate with leaders in higher education, school districts and education-focused non-profits to identify areas of opportunity to enrich the schools in our community. In partnership, the Firstmark Foundation board will approve the funding of significant needs across the school districts, such as constructing new facilities, improving existing amenities, enhancing learning spaces and providing educator grants and student scholarships.

Pérez-Díaz is currently pursuing her doctoral degree in educational leadership from the University of Texas at San Antonio and is the proud wife of a school district trustee and mother of three.

The Power to Make an Impact Together

Firstmark said it recently introduced the Power of the Dollar checking product to include a $1 impact fee. The monthly impact fee goes directly to the Firstmark Foundation.
